The catch is that nonprofit Bank card Financial obligation Mercy isn't for everyone. To qualify, you have to not have made a payment on your charge card account, or accounts, for 120-180 days. Additionally, not all financial institutions participate, and it's only offered by a couple of not-for-profit credit rating counseling firms. InCharge Financial debt Solutions is just one of them.



The Credit Card Mercy Program is for people who are so much behind on debt card settlements that they are in severe monetary trouble, perhaps encountering insolvency, and don't have the revenue to catch up."The program is particularly created to aid clients whose accounts have actually been charged off," Mostafa Imakhchachen, client treatment specialist at InCharge Debt Solutions, stated.

Creditors that take part have actually concurred with the nonprofit credit report therapy company to approve 50%-60% of what is owed in dealt with month-to-month repayments over 36 months. The fixed payments imply you recognize precisely just how much you'll pay over the settlement duration. No passion is charged on the balances during the payoff period, so the settlements and amount owed don't alter.
